Comfort

Patagonia Capilene Cool Daily Hoody

4.6/ 5.0

Arc'teryx Cormac Hoody

4.8/ 5.0

Comfort is crucial for sun shirts, as it directly impacts your overall hiking experience. A more comfortable shirt can make long hikes more enjoyable and less fatiguing. The Arc'teryx Cormac Hoody excels in this category with its silky, soft feel and moisture-wicking properties, which keep you comfortable during extended wear. Users have consistently praised its comfort, highlighting aspects like its very soft and really nice fabric. The Patagonia Capilene Cool Daily Hoody also offers good comfort with its lightweight and breathable fabric, but it can feel stiffer and less silky compared to the Arc'teryx. Therefore, if comfort is your top priority, the Arc'teryx Cormac Hoody is the better choice.

Sun Protection

Patagonia Capilene Cool Daily Hoody

4.7/ 5.0

Arc'teryx Cormac Hoody

4.3/ 5.0

Sun protection is a vital feature for any sun shirt, especially for hikers who spend long hours under direct sunlight. The Patagonia Capilene Cool Daily Hoody shines in this category with its UPF 50+ rating and excellent coverage, including thumb loops to prevent hand burns and a button enclosure to cover your face. Users have praised its ability to keep the sun off your body and protect your skin effectively. While the Arc'teryx Cormac Hoody also offers a UPF 50+ rating and good coverage, it lacks some of the additional sun protection features found in the Patagonia hoody. Thus, for superior sun protection, the Patagonia Capilene Cool Daily Hoody is the clear winner.

Durability

Patagonia Capilene Cool Daily Hoody

4.6/ 5.0

Arc'teryx Cormac Hoody

4.3/ 5.0

Durability ensures that your sun shirt can withstand the rigors of outdoor activities and last for multiple seasons. The Patagonia Capilene Cool Daily Hoody is built for exposed conditions and is made from 100% recycled jersey knit material, which users have found to be extremely durable with no holes, rips, or loose threads even after prolonged use. The Arc'teryx Cormac Hoody is also durable and abrasion-resistant, but it doesn't quite match the level of durability offered by the Patagonia hoody. Therefore, if you need a sun shirt that can handle tough conditions and frequent use, the Patagonia Capilene Cool Daily Hoody is the better option.

Fit

Patagonia Capilene Cool Daily Hoody

3.7/ 5.0

Arc'teryx Cormac Hoody

4.2/ 5.0

The fit of a sun shirt can affect both comfort and functionality, influencing how well it protects you from the sun and how comfortable it feels during wear. The Arc'teryx Cormac Hoody offers a tailored fit with plenty of room and stretch, making it comfortable for a variety of body types. Users have appreciated its loose and baggy fit, which provides ample space and air flow. The Patagonia Capilene Cool Daily Hoody, while offering a relaxed fit, can feel a bit snug around the shoulders and neck, which some users have found uncomfortable. Therefore, for a more comfortable and accommodating fit, the Arc'teryx Cormac Hoody is the better choice.

Heat Management

Patagonia Capilene Cool Daily Hoody

4.7/ 5.0

Arc'teryx Cormac Hoody

4.1/ 5.0

Effective heat management is essential for staying cool and comfortable during hot and humid hikes. The Patagonia Capilene Cool Daily Hoody excels in this category with its highly breathable fabric that wicks moisture and dries quickly, keeping you cool even in hot conditions. Users have praised its ability to dissipate heat and keep you dry. While the Arc'teryx Cormac Hoody is also breathable and moisture-wicking, some users have noted that it can feel slightly warm in hot weather. Therefore, for superior heat management, the Patagonia Capilene Cool Daily Hoody is the better option.

Conclusion & Final Verdict:

In conclusion, both the Patagonia Capilene Cool Daily Hoody and the Arc'teryx Cormac Hoody are excellent choices for sun protection during hiking. The Patagonia hoody stands out for its superior sun protection and heat management, making it ideal for intense sun exposure and hot conditions. On the other hand, the Arc'teryx hoody offers better comfort and fit, ensuring all-day wearability.

Choose the Patagonia Capilene Cool Daily Hoody if you prioritize sun protection and staying cool in hot weather. Opt for the Arc'teryx Cormac Hoody if you value comfort and a more tailored fit.
